Understanding Emotional Safety:

Emotional safety is the foundation of any meaningful relationship. It is the feeling of being accepted, valued, and protected, allowing individuals to express their true selves without fear of judgment or rejection. When emotional safety is absent, individuals may find themselves in a constant state of anxiety, constantly questioning their worth and the sincerity of their connections. This can manifest in various ways, such as avoiding deep conversations, being overly defensive, or feeling emotionally isolated.

Signs of a Connection Without Emotional Safety:

Identifying a connection without emotional safety is essential in order to address the underlying issues and work towards a healthier relationship. Some common signs include:

1. Lack of Trust: Individuals may find it difficult to trust their partner, leading to constant suspicion and paranoia.
2. Fear of Rejection: The fear of being rejected or abandoned can prevent individuals from fully engaging in the relationship.
3. Communication Breakdowns: Without emotional safety, conversations may become tense, filled with misunderstandings, and a lack of empathy.
4. Emotional Distance: Individuals may feel emotionally disconnected from their partner, struggling to find common ground and share their feelings.
5. Negative Impact on Self-Esteem: The constant stress and anxiety associated with a lack of emotional safety can lead to diminished self-esteem and self-worth.

Consequences of a Connection Without Emotional Safety:

Living in a connection without emotional safety can have severe consequences on an individual’s mental and emotional well-being. Some of the potential outcomes include:

1. Depression and Anxiety: The constant stress and fear of rejection can lead to the development of depression and anxiety disorders.
2. Relationship Issues: The absence of emotional safety can lead to the breakdown of the relationship, as both partners struggle to maintain a healthy bond.
3. Isolation: Individuals may withdraw from friends and family, feeling emotionally isolated and unsupported.
4. Negative Impact on Personal Growth: Without the support and encouragement of a healthy relationship, individuals may struggle to grow and develop as individuals.

Seeking Emotional Safety:

In order to foster a connection with emotional safety, it is essential to work on the following aspects:

1. Open Communication: Encourage open and honest communication, allowing both partners to express their feelings and concerns without fear of judgment.
2. Trust Building: Focus on building trust through consistent actions and demonstrating sincerity.
3. Empathy and Understanding: Show empathy towards your partner’s feelings and try to understand their perspective.
4. Setting Boundaries: Establish clear boundaries to ensure that both partners feel respected and secure.
5. Professional Help: In some cases, seeking the help of a therapist or counselor may be beneficial in addressing the underlying issues and fostering emotional safety.
